Abstract
Technologies are described herein for an illumination device and a corresponding fixture device. The illumination device includes a luminary module for the emission of light and an identification circuit containing identifying data, while the fixture device includes a driver module for supplying power to the illumination device and a controller module. When the illumination device is connected to the fixture device, the controller module communicates with the identification circuit of the illumination device to retrieve the identifying data and causes the driver module to supply the appropriate power to the luminary module of the illumination device.

1. A lighting system, comprising:
-
an illumination device comprising a luminary module and an identification circuit; and a fixture device comprising a driver module and a controller module, wherein the illumination device is detachably connected to the fixture device, the driver module is configured to supply power to the luminary module, and the controller module is configured to communicate with the identification circuit of the illumination device to retrieve data and control the driver module according to the data; read the identifying data from the identification circuit; retrieve driver parameters regarding the luminary module associated with the identifying data from a central database; and cause the driver module to supply power to the luminary module of the illumination device according to the driver parameters. - View Dependent Claims (2, 3, 4, 5, 7, 8, 9, 10, 11, 12, 13, 14, 15, 16, 17, 18)

6. The system of claim l, wherein the driver parameters comprise one or more of a current value, a brightness, an operational life, a modulation frequency value, a voltage value, and a heat/thermocouple value.

22. A method of authenticating an illumination device detachably connected to a fixture device, the method comprising:
-
initializing an identification circuit on the illumination device; communicating with the identification circuit to retrieve identifying data regarding the illumination device; determine if the illumination device is authentic based on the identifying data; upon determining the illumination device is authentic, supplying power to a luminary module of the illumination device; and upon determining that the illumination device is not authentic, disabling the power to the illumination device. - View Dependent Claims (23, 24)
